Tonight's task of cleaning your commercial building is a big one, but it doesn't have to be daunting! (Firstly,) start by making a list of all the tasks that need to get done. (For example:) sweep and mop the floors; dust shelves and counters; empty trash bins, vacuum carpets; clean windows, mirrors, and doors; wipe down surfaces with disinfectant. Don't forget to add in details like dusting light fixtures or polishing furniture!
Next, prioritize these tasks so that you know which ones are most essential to get done first. This will help ensure that nothing gets left behind! Try assigning each task a numerical value from 1-10 with 10 being the highest priority. It'll make it much easier to determine which steps you need to take first.
Furthermore, while doing this job you may come across items that need repairing or replacing - maybe broken chairs or cracked tiles etc. Make sure you record these things separately so they don't go unnoticed!
Additionally, it may be helpful to create checklists for each room so that you can keep track of the progress made as well as any other extra tasks that might have been forgotten during the initial planning stage. Emptying all the (trash cans) and replacing the liners is an important task for keeping a clean commercial building. It's not a difficult job, but it needs to be done! You need to make sure that you have enough liners on hand (so you don't run out). Negatively, you'll also need to be careful when disposing of any potentially hazardous materials.
First, start by removing all the trash from each can. Then, take out the old liner and dispose of it correctly. Following this, put in a fresh one before adding back the trash. Make sure that each can has been covered properly with its new liner before moving onto another.
Moreover, don't forget to check if there are any areas around which need extra attention such as behind or underneath furniture. Also, make sure none of the garbage has ended up outside of the bins! Afterward, double-check that every bin has been emptied and lined properly.

Vacuuming carpets and upholstered furniture is a must for any commercial building tonight! It's (essential) to get rid of dust, dirt, and other particles that can build up over time. Not only does this make the space look better, but it also helps reduce allergens in the air.
However, vacuuming isn't always easy. You need to use the right tools and techniques to ensure you're cleaning effectively. First, pick an appropriate vacuum cleaner with strong suction power. Be sure to check for attachments like crevice tools or brushes which come in handy when reaching those hard-to-reach areas. Next, work systematically from one side of the room to another to avoid missing any spots. Finally, remember that some fabric types may require special care so be sure to consult your manual or do research online if necessary!
